Joao Felix comments on potential Benfica return

Joao Felix has commented on his liking for Benfica and suggested a potential return to his former club could be a possibility either this summer or in the future.

Joao Felix is expected to be on the move again this summer following his return to Chelsea last year. The Portuguese international is a well-travelled player, having played for numerous clubs throughout his career, although that may not be something he would have wanted.

Felix was a massive signing for Atletico Madrid many years ago, when the Spanish giants paid a hefty sum to secure one of the most talented teenagers in the world. His time at Atletico Madrid started well, but soon it became clear that manager Diego Simeone was not satisfied and had wanted him out in a few years.

A short-term loan to Chelsea did not bear any fruit, and while he was very good for Barcelona during his solitary season there, the financial aspects of any deal made it impossible for the Blaugrana to sign him. Last summer, there were some complicated business dealings between Chelsea and Atletico Madrid, and the Felix move to Stamford Bridge was a repercussion of their failed move for Samu Aghehowa.

Joao Felix left Chelsea for a loan move to AC Milan in January, and once again, after impressing in the early stages, the Rossoneri had long decided not to make the move permanent. He was already linked with a move to former side Benfica well before the season ended, and it appears there is some fire in these links.

Felix was asked about his impending future at Chelsea and specifically about a possible return to Benfica. In his comments that appeared on A Bola, the struggling Chelsea 2024 signing did hint at being open to a potential return to the Lisbon side, although he did not give the notion of moving there immediately and kept the prospect open for the future.

Joao Felix said, “Benfica is my home. One day I will return. I don’t know if it will be now or in a few years. If it is now, I will be happy”, added Félix, who prefers the club he holds dear. “Everyone knows that Benfica is the club of my heart. One day I will certainly return. I don’t know if it will be now or in the future. I have a few ideas in my head. Either stay in England or return to Benfica.”

Chelsea are not interested in having Felix in the team anymore, even though the player has a contract until 2031. Moreover, the Blues have made some tremendous signings to improve their attack, as the Portuguese star may have further seen his place diminished on Enzo Maresca’s side.

Benfica were reportedly planning on opening talks, either with the player or Chelsea about a possible move. They are reportedly willing to make a financial commitment of around €30 million to test Chelsea’s resolve, although they are still unsure about paying Felix high wages given they have a €4 million a year salary cap.

Should a move to Benfica materialise, Joao Felix might be open, but there are other teams interested, including Saudi sides Neom FC and Al-Nassr. There’s also interest from Flamengo, although there’s a feeling the struggling Chelsea 2024 signing might prefer a switch back to Benfica if an offer came by.
